摘要
Previous laboratory studies indicated existence of ceramides and ceramide monochexosides in brown rice grain. More recently evidence was obtained for the presence of these and other sphingolipids (ceramide dihexosides and ceramide trihexosides) in rice bran. The isolation and chemical analysis of constituents of ceramides and ceramide monohexosides in rice bran are described. Ceramide, ceramide monohexoside, ceramide dihexoside and ceramide trihexoside were detected in rice bran. The ceramide and ceramide monohexoside fractions were isolated, and their constituents were analyzed. In the ceramide, fatty acid components consisted of 3 types: normal, 2-hydroxy and 2,3-dihydroxy acids, mainly 2-hydroxylignoceric acid. The major long-chain base components were trihydroxy bases, principally 4-hydroxysphinganine. The principal fatty acid and long-chain base components in the ceramide monohexoside were 2-hydroxyarachidic acid and sphinga-4,8-dienine isomers and 4-hydroxy-8-sphingenine. The component sugar was mostly glucose.
